Plaid powers the tools millions of people rely on to live a healthier financial life. We work with thousands of companies like Venmo, SoFi, several of the Fortune 500, and many of the largest banks to make it easy for people to connect their financial accounts to the apps and services they want to use. Plaid’s network covers 12,000 financial institutions across the US, Canada, UK and Europe. Founded in 2013, the company is headquartered in San Francisco with offices in New York, Washington D.C., London and Amsterdam.
As Implementation Specialists, we are responsible for guiding and helping Plaid’s most strategic customers and partners integrate with Plaid solutions. We work closely with both Account Executives and Account Managers, in addition to many other internal teams such as Sales, Product, and Support. In this role, you will be responsible for the implementation phase in the customer lifecycle and ensure net-new Enterprise Plaid customers are properly onboarded and our solution is implemented and launched successfully. This stage is incredibly important in the success of our customers, as for many, their Plaid integration is the foundation of their application and / or platform.
You will be a highly visible technical and product expert in Plaid's offerings, working with some of Plaid’s largest and most strategic customers in the Enterprise segment to answer their technical product and integration questions. You’ll approach every engagement with a consideration for long term strategy and use creative problem solving and project management skills to keep customers on track to launch. When technical issues arise, you’ll leverage internal tools, teams, and resources to ensure customers meet their milestones. You will support customers as they test, pilot and ultimately launch their Plaid integrations. Members of the Implementation team are expected to manage multiple implementations / customers and partners simultaneously, and to stay up to date on Plaid’s technological improvements and new product offerings.
